‘Career Suicide’ is a side-step from its predecessor, ‘Flight Of The Raven’, more melodic, taking a trip into glam on its title track and visiting The Damned on ‘Avalanche’ for a beer or ten. ‘Frostbiter’ and ‘Can’t See, Don’t Care, Don’t Know’ are closer to the duo’s earlier hellbastard hardcore attack, while ‘Heart Attack In My Head’ rumbles monstrously like Motörhead in battle mode.
